Features and Benefits

Watch your savings grow
We make it easy to get on--and stay on--a budget. Set suggested spending limits and savings goals based on the information you enter into Quicken day-by-day.

An intuitive "Spending Planner" summarizes your actual spending and compares it to what you planned to spend for the month. Check your progress at a glance, and quickly see where you have room to spend or need to save more.

Quicken Deluxe can also help you create customized plans to reduce/eliminate debt--and to save for a house, college, retirement or large purchase.

See where your money's going
Quicken Deluxe shows you what you have coming in, going out, and most importantly, what's left over to spend or save. Check in anytime to see exactly where your personal finances are for the week, month or year.

View your accounts all in one place
Organizes your finances by bringing your online accounts together--including checking, savings and credit cards. Avoid the hassle of going to multiple websites. Now you can see it all in one place with just ONE password. Access over 6,700 banks, brokerages and other financial institutions--including PayPal.

Never miss a bill
See what bills have already been paid, what's coming up, and if you have enough left in your accounts to cover them--all in one convenient place. Set reminders to pay bills on time and instantly check the status of past bills.

What's New in 2010

Already using Quicken? Reasons to upgrade now:

New--See your most important info in one place
The new Quicken home page puts all your most important financial information in one easy-to-understand window, so you can see how you're doing at a glance.

Improved--Find the tools you need, faster
The improved menu and toolbar make it easier to find the tools you need to help organize your personal finances.

New--Getting started is a breeze
It's simpler than ever to put Quicken to work for you--so you can reach your personal finance goals faster. With the new Guided Setup, you just answer a few simple questions; we'll show you how Quicken works, and what to do next. You'll see your total financial picture come into focus even sooner than you expect.

New--Avoid late fees and penalties
We help you avoid overdraft fees and penalties--by showing you how much you'll have left in your account until your next paycheck.

Improved--Check for accuracy
We've made it easier to review your transactions, so you can quickly spot anything that looks inaccurate or out of place. If a transaction requires follow-up, you can flag it with a reminder.

Improved--Get tips from other Quicken users
With Quicken's Live Community, you can get help and advice from other Quicken users without ever leaving Quicken. If you have a question about something specific you're trying to do, just look to Live Community on the right of the Quicken screen for the answer.

5 out of 5 stars Loved it and the Download option   November 12, 2009
Just Anonymous (Georgia, USA)
18 out of 18 found this review helpful

My computer recently crashed due to a lightning strike so I've been rebuilding. I thought it would be a great time to upgrade my quicken as I went to Windows 7 on my machines.

I was dreading having to order the package and wait the couple of days to get it in the mail because my significant other wanted this little project done in one day. I was very happy to find that this product was available for download and at a very competitive price.

THE DOWNLOAD:

I purchased this and then got an e-mail to download it right away. It was installed in 15 minutes. It's only about 60MB download and it came down really fast over broadband. If you're on dialup, Amazon has a little application that you download that can help you do downloads overnight and if you drop your connection, you can pick up where you left off. Still, if you use dialup, you might just want to order the software.

Overall, I was happy with the download

PRODUCT:
If you're a quicken user, this is just quicken. They did a facelift to it so that it looks somewhat like Office 2007, bigger buttons at the top.

I'll tell you what I liked right off the bat:
a) I was using Quicken 2005 and integration with my Bank was very very seamless with Quicken 2010
b) Since I lost my data from the lighting strike, I wasn't able to test recovery or upgrading files (I'm sure that's standard)
c) I liked that the default is a transaction is in one line (in 2005 transactions by default took too lines)


Overall, it's Quicken - it keeps track of my books and integrates nicely with my bank. I like it. I can't say I love it because I don't love balancing my checkbook and no matter what software was out there, it would still be a chore to do this job that needs to get done. I have to say, Quicken makes it about as easy as you possibly can.

Get it, use it, it runs on Vista and Windows 7. It's stable and reliable. Don't get hit by lighting like my pc or all bets are off.

5 out of 5 stars Successfully converted from MS Money to Quicken Deluxe 2010   August 24, 2010
ccie8020
1 out of 1 found this review helpful

After all of the horror stories I have been dreading this conversion for a month. But I had purchased a new laptop and needed to get off of my old one and this was the last outstanding item. All things considered, it went flawlessly. Here are some notes:

1. You must first install Quicken on a computer with Money 2007 or 2008 if you want to use the conversion tool. I was able to convert 6 years worth of data in under a minute.
2. I was able to download Quicken files from my bank and import them.
3. On the downloaded file from my bank's website, I overlapped one day and it did create duplicates. I simply voided the original transactions that were duplicated and it worked fine after that.
4. On the first credit card download using Quicken's automatic update, it created 8 duplicates out of 841 transactions. Once again, I voided the original transactions, categorized the new ones, and had no more issues on future downloads.
5. I had to change my category structure and use the Quicken category groups to get my budget report to look the way I wanted it to. It took a couple of hours of tweaking and comparing to my MS Money budget report but once I was done, I actually liked it better.
6. My original laptop was a 32bit Vista OS and my new one is a Windows 7 64 bit install. I had no Quicken installation issues on either system.

Please note, I only use the transaction download and budgeting features but I use them avidly. I send out updated Year to Date budget reports to my wife every week along with transaction details for the current month. I am able to accomplish this as quickly if not quicker than I was able to in Money. Maybe it was because my expectations were so low but I am completely satisfied with this product.
